Juicy layered salad with turnips
Juicy layered salad with turnips

Portions: 6 persons | Preparation: 75 minutes

Layers of crisp white turnips make the salad super juicy. Boiled potatoes and carrots perfectly complement the turnip, and the apple brings a light, pleasant acidity to the salad.

Season: Spring, Summer | Region: Europe | Preparation: Cook | Menu: Salads | Cuisine: Polish recipes

Ingredients

  • 2 potatoes
  • 2 carrots
  • 3 eggs
  • 2-3 turnips
  • Salt, to taste
  • Black pepper, to taste
  • 100-150 g mayonnaise
  • ⅓ leek
  • 1 apple, best sweet and sour variety
  • dill, for garnish

Utensils

  • pot
  • grater
  • knife
  • cutting board
  • glass bowl

Instructions

  • Cook potatoes and carrots for 25-30 minutes, eggs for 10 minutes.
  • Let the vegetables and eggs cool down.
  • Grate the potatoes and carrots separately.
  • Finely chop the leeks.
  • Separate the egg whites from the yolks and also grate.
  • Peel the turnips and grate on a coarse grater.
  • Lightly salt, mix and divide into three equal parts.
  • Put the coarsely grated potatoes in a glass bowl.
  • Lightly salt and pepper and spread with mayonnaise.
  • Next, layer one-third of the grated turnips.
  • Layer the chopped leeks and grated carrots.
  • Spread with mayonnaise.
  • Season with salt and pepper, if you like.
  • Then layer the turnips, grated apple, and turnips again.
  • Lay out the grated egg whites and brush with mayonnaise.
  • Sprinkle the finished layered salad with the egg yolks.
  • Garnish with dill before serving.
  • The layered salad with turnips goes wonderfully with the grill. Kohlrabi or radishes can also be used instead of turnips.
